It's always been a sticky one this.
Detailing an emergency frequency list.

Comes with working with a mixture of disciplines and about 3000 odd individuals called preppers. Confused

If anyone is brave enough to detail a set, others will disagree. Angry

Hams seem have a set (depending on what day it is and who's in charge) Tongue

CB'ers for the past 40 years have used Channel 9.
Mode depends on which country you are in. Smile

Marine VHF Channel 16 156.00 Mhz NFM (That's international)
Air 121.5 Mhz AM or 243 Mhz if you want to upset the military.

And then it gets complicated.

PMR 446. Which one?
Analogue PMR you've got 8 choices
Digital FDMA you've got 16 choices
Digital TMDA you've got 8 choices

PLUS all your CTSS or DCS variants gives you a total of 69 choices.

Go on, be brave, call one, I dare you Big Grin Big Grin Big Grin
